#!/bin/bash
DESTINATION=$(zenity --title="Select a folder" --file-selection --directory)
OLDIFS=$IFS
IFS=$'\n'
for FILE in $CAJA_SCRIPT_SELECTED_FILE_PATHS
do
mv -i "$FILE" "$DESTINATION"
done
IFS=$OLDIFS
kreemoweet wrote:In my version of Caja, moving seems to be the default action when dragging&dropping a file. To get an actual menu item, you could put a MoveTo script file in the
Caja scripts folder. "MoveTo" would then appear in the Scripts submenu of any file's context menu.
This is the one I have, using zenity because I found matedialog to be less than satisfactory:
- Code: Select all
#!/bin/bash
DESTINATION=$(zenity --title="Select a folder" --file-selection --directory)
OLDIFS=$IFS
IFS=$'\n'
for FILE in $CAJA_SCRIPT_SELECTED_FILE_PATHS
do
mv -i "$FILE" "$DESTINATION"
done
IFS=$OLDIFS
Return to Desktop & Multimedia
Users browsing this forum: No registered users and 3 guests